I haven't heard much about Dublin Boon (I keep saying, Benson in my head lol). The reserve team have 3 goalkeepers in their squad, and Nathan Langeveld seems to be preferred.
Stellenbosch DDC reserve team are in the top 3 in the league so they maintaining their high standard (I think they came second last season). The competition is high as the winners of the league traditionally get sent to Europe to play reserve teams in top European leagues.
Last year's winners, Kaizer Chiefs will be playing Man Utd, Leeds and QPR reserves in the next few days. For township kids (mostly) who have never travelled before (not counting those that frequently go on trial) it's a HUGE incentive to win the Reserve League.
